Defect SummaryKeystone is recalling certain recreational vehicles equipped with dimplex electraflame, symphony, or optiflame branded electric fireplaces, stoves, and fireplace inserts. the plug in remote control receiver for the fireplace can overheat.
Consequence SummaryAn overheated receiver could cause a fire.
Corrective SummaryKeystone is working with dimplex and dimplex will provide owners a free replacement plug-in remote control kit. the safety recall began on january 28, 2011. owners may contact dimplex north america customer service at 1-888-346-7539.

Defect SummaryCertain fifth wheel and travel trailers equipped with a two-door refrigerator, manufactured by the dometic corporation, may have a defect in certain tubing in the refrigerator which could allow pressurized flammable coolant solution to be released into an area where an ignition source (gas flame) is present.
Consequence SummaryThis could result in a fire.
Corrective SummaryKeystone rv will be working with dometic in order to repair these refrigerators (please see 06e076). dometic will repair these refrigerators by installing a secondary burner housing and thermal fuses free of charge. dometic has retained stericycle inc. to manage this campaign. stericycle will assist you in locating dealerships or service centers and will provide assistance with scheduling of appointments. owners may contact dometic/stericycle at 1-888-446-5157 or keystone rv at 574-535-2100.

 I have a 2002 keystone montana fifth wheel rv. last year i took it in the shop because my slideout was moving when it was hooked to the tow vehicle. long story short, it has been in the shop four times and their are still problems with the frame. the problem is the welds keep breaking on the frame. the shop told me i was lucky, that with the way the welds are breaking, the whole unit could have fallen apart or off the frame while on the highway. still not sure how to fix this. there were no incidents caused the failure. so far it has cost close to $8000.00 in repairs and it still breaks. upon googling this problem, there are many hits where all state the same problem. the problem is the frame is too weak to support the trailer's weight. my repair shop called me and said they have another keystone trailer that just came in for the same problem. what are the chances in a small town for that to happen? on a side note, i had problems with the tires, they kept blowing. i notice many many rv manufactures put tires on with minimal clearance for the weight of the trailer, and also put axles that are barely rated for the trailers as well. you put a pillow in the trailer and you are over your axle and tire weight rating. i installed tires of the next load rating up and have not had a single problem. i had the same problem with the tires on my previous trailer, a nuwa fifth wheel. they kept blowing and finally i replaced them all with the next size up. this problem truly is a road hazard, having a blow out on a rv going 65mph on the freeway. also, the problem of having the trailer falling off a failed frame while traveling on the freeway. *tr
